Maintains Precise Conductor Alignment: The primary function of the head board is to keep the two sub-conductors of a bundle perfectly parallel and at the correct spacing throughout the pulling process. This precise alignment is crucial for the aerodynamic and electrical performance of the finished line. It prevents the conductors from twisting around each other or clashing, which could cause damage to the conductor surface and negatively impact the long term performance of the transmission line. -
Distributes Pulling Force Evenly: The head board is designed to distribute the immense tensile force from the puller or tugger equally between the two conductors. This balanced force distribution is vital to prevent one conductor from being tensioned more than the other, which could lead to uneven sag and potentially damage the conductors or the hardware they are attached to. It ensures that both conductors in the bundle share the mechanical load equally. -
Robust Construction for Heavy Duty Use: Manufactured from high strength aluminum alloy or forged steel, the head board is built to handle the extreme stresses of conductor stringing. Its design includes reinforced connection points and a solid frame to resist bending or deformation under heavy loads, providing the durability needed for repeated use on demanding utility projects. -
Protects Conductor Integrity: A key benefit of using a proper head board is the protection it offers to the conductors. It features smooth, rounded contact surfaces and sheaves that guide the conductors without causing abrasion, crushing, or scratching the sensitive outer strands. This careful handling preserves the conductor's strength and electrical properties, preventing points of future failure. -
